Does a 100 gram piece of iron have twice the density of a 50 gram piece of iron?

Since density is defined as mass divided by volume, the statement that the 100g piece of iron has twice the density as the 50g piece would only be true if they occupied the same volume. However, since iron is an element, it will not vary so widely in density in solid form. Thus, it is more than likely that they are different volumes with the same density, and only the mass of the first piece is twice the mass of the second.

Does density change if the sample of the same matter is larger?

No density if a characteristic of matter. Density can vary with temperature and pressure, but a chunk of something twice the volume of another chunk of the same substance will weigh twice as much because the two chunks have the same density.


What is the secret to planting tomato by black walnut trees?

I'm a lifelong gardener, and I can answer this for you with assurance: The secret is, DON'T.The juglone naturally released by black walnut roots will kill tomato plants in a matter of days.Never plant tomatoes closer than twice the dripline distance from a black walnut.


How does the mass relate to volume and density?

Mass relates linearly to volume and density. That is to say if you have twice as much volume of the same material (say water) it has twice the mass. If you have something twice as dense at the same volume, it has twice the mass. Note: this applies specifically to mass-density, the most common use of the word. Things like energy-density or population density have a more complicated and often less meaningful relation to mass.

Why does density always stay the same regardless of the mass?

Density is a physical property of a material that is determined by its mass and volume. As long as the shape and arrangement of the material remain the same, the density will also remain constant regardless of the mass present. This is because density is defined as mass divided by volume, so as the mass increases, the volume also increases proportionally to keep the density constant.
